Đồng hợp kim Nhôm C95400 (Aluminium Bronze C95400) | |
Copper (Cu) | 83% min |
Alluminium (Al) | 10.5~11.5% |
Furrum (Fe) | 3.0~5.0% |
Nickel (Ni) | 1.5% max (+Co) |
Manganum (Mn) | 0.50% max |
0.2% Proof Stress(N/㎟) | 205 min |
Tensile Strength(Mpa, min.) | 515 min |
Elongation(min. %) | 13 min |
Hardness | min. 140 HBW |
